Comprehending Your Dog's Language

Your furry companion shares their world with you in a language all its own. Though they may not speak copyright, their tail wags, ear positions, and even their body language can reveal a wealth of information about how they're feeling. Decoding these subtle cues can strengthen your bond and create a more harmonious relationship with your canine partner.

A wagging tail doesn't always imply happiness. The speed, direction, and form of the wag can tell you if your dog is excited, anxious, or even defensive. Likewise, a raised hackle often suggests fear or tension, while lowered ears can show submission or anxiety.

Paying attention to your dog's overall attitude can give you even deeper understandings. Do they approach with strangers warily? Are they attentive when you speak to them? These are all important pieces of the puzzle that can help you deeply understand your dog's inner world.

Creature Comfort: Keeping Your Best Friend Safe

Bringing a new furry companion into your home is an exciting event. But with new excitement comes the responsibility of ensuring their safety and well-being. Every pet, regardless of size or species, deserves a safe and nurturing environment.

Here are some essential tips to keep your best friend happy:

* Always supervise interactions between your pet and young children. Teach kids how to play safely with your furry friend.

* Make sure your yard is securely contained to prevent escapes and potential dangers.

* Tuck away potentially harmful substances like cleaning products, medications, and toxic plants in a safe location.

* Provide your pet with plenty of fresh drink and nutritious food to support their growth.

* Maintain their hygiene to prevent mats and tangles, and inspect for pests.

Remember, being a responsible pet owner means putting their needs first. By following these simple tips, you can help ensure that your furry companion lives a long, happy life.

Traveling with Your Pets: A Guide to Stress-Free Adventures

Embarking thru a grand adventure with your furry companion? It can be an fantastic experience for both you and your pet, but proper planning is key to ensuring a stress-free trip. First things first, make sure your pet is healthy enough for travel. A consultation with your veterinarian can help identify any potential issues and ensure they are up-to-date on vaccinations.

Next, gather all the essential supplies your pet will need. This entails food, water, a comfortable bed, their favorite snacks, and any necessary medicine. Refrain from forgetting essential papers like your pet's vaccination records and identification tags. When traveling by vehicle, make sure your pet is securely confined in a copyright to prevent accident. If you are flying, be certain to check the airline's guidelines regarding pets.

Frequent Pet Health Concerns: Prevention and Care

Maintaining your furry companion's well-being is paramount. By understanding common pet health concerns, you can proactively implement preventative measures and provide optimal care. Regular pet checkups are essential for early detection and treatment of any potential ailments. A balanced feeding plan, proper exercise, and a peaceful environment all contribute to a strong lifestyle for your pet.

  • Vaccinations are essential for protecting your pet from serious diseases.
  • Worming medication is crucial to prevent infestations that can cause problems.
  • Oral hygiene helps prevent dental illness which can impact overall health.
